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57262 28629011573 44
76687992243 73682266658
76687992243 73682266658
4002180 654 728470
All about undefined
Interested in learning more?
76687992243 73682266658
4002180 654 728470
See more
77722 5664
280842279 8839996 9603213769
See more
92032977 95952743312
0719 828417 4460729142 7581507366
See more